Join Aledade as a Practice Transformation Specialist (PTS) for our South Carolina practices and personally make an impact on patient care. Practice Transformation Specialists are HQ’s most direct interface with providers and can glean valuable insight into our partner practice’s happiness and needs. A successful PTS is passionate about population health and highly mission-oriented around providing better care to patients while reducing costs.

At Aledade, a PTS can impact the health of their community by transforming one practice at a time.

Please note: candidates must be based in South Carolina to be considered.

Primary Duties:

Direct Practice Support:

  • Implement products and execute ACO initiatives with direction from Market Leadership.
  • Accountable for implementing and supporting wellness visits, transitions of care, active management, and ensuring practices meet goals set forth in mutually developed Practice Transformation Plans.

ACO Training & Development:

  • Work to assist in training office staff and physicians & providers (in coordination with Aledade's Value Based Care Curriculum) on processes and technologies.
  • Provide continual assessment of practice’s and staff’s training needs.
  • Develop and nurture lasting relationships and engagement with physicians, providers, and healthcare system executives to support and enhance financial and quality performance across performance metrics.

Customer Success:

  • Listen to practices' concerns, relaying important information to Manager/Leads to understand opportunities for improvement.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Must be a resident of South Carolina.
  • Graduate of an accredited college or university. 4-6 years of significant and relevant work experience in medical practice management in lieu of educational requirements may be accepted, particularly with significant administrative experience in a clinic setting.
  • 3 years of experience with Electronic Health Records (EHR) for clinical/practice management processes.

Preferred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:

  • Excellent oral and written communication skills (e.g., public presentation skills), organizational and project management skills, and team-building skills.
  • Familiarity with process mapping and workflow analysis tools.
  • Excellent computer skills and willingness to learn additional software applications.

Physical Requirements:

  • Sitting for prolonged periods of time.
  • Extensive use of computers and keyboard.
  • Occasional walking and lifting may be required.
  • Ability to travel to practices up to 25% in South Carolina (approximately a few times a month).

Aledade is a healthcare company and a physician-led public benefit corporation that operates the largest network of independent primary care practices in the United States. The company specializes in building and managing Accountable Care Organizations (ACOs). By partnering with independent clinics, community health centers, and physicians, Aledade helps providers transition from a traditional fee-for-service approach to a value-based care model. They equip practices with data analytics, AI-driven technology, personal coaching, and regulatory expertise to improve patient health outcomes, reduce overall medical costs, and ensure the financial sustainability and clinical autonomy of independent primary care.
